What is a no experience 35 hour job?

'No Experience 35 Hour' jobs refer to positions that do not require previous work experience and typically offer 35 hours of work per week, which is often considered full-time or close to full-time in many workplaces. These jobs are ideal for individuals entering the workforce for the first time, such as recent graduates or those changing careers. Common examples include entry-level administrative roles, retail positions, customer service, or warehouse work. Employers offering these positions usually provide on-the-job training to help new hires learn the necessary skills. The 35-hour schedule can offer a good balance between work and personal life while still providing steady income.

Looking for a flexible, challenging and rewarding opportunity to work with infants, toddlers and their families? Join our team of dedicated professionals who make a daily difference in the lives of young children by providing quality, home-based early intervention services.

Sunny Days of California, Inc. specializes in the area of early intervention, serving children with developmental needs from birth to three years of age. Sunny Days is a nationwide agency and has programs throughout the state of California. Our programs are multi-disciplinary, providing occupational, physical, and speech therapy, as well as child development services.

We are looking to grow our team of Child Development Specialists in your area!

Job Responsibilities:

  • Conduct developmental assessments, provide child development services utilizing the Parent Coaching Model (Rush & Sheldon)
  • Follow each childs Individualized Family Service Plan (IFSP) and work with the family to develop strategies to help each child reach their specific developmental goals
  • Utilize the family-centered parent coaching approach to build caregivers confidence and skills and to ensure that progress is generalized
  • Provide services in the childs natural environment, in families homes, daycare centers and/or other community settings.
  • Provide re-assessments and write progress reports (typically bi-annual)
  • Maintain confidentiality of information regarding children and families (in accordance with HIPAA and/or State/Federal regulations)
